【300k-ton LIB Recycling and Reutilization Project Signed in Weiyuan, Sichuan】 Recently, the government of Weiyuan County, Neijiang, Sichuan, signed an agreement for the 300,000-ton/year LIB recycling and reutilization project. According to public information, the project is located in the Weiyuan Shale Gas Comprehensive Utilization Chemical Industrial Park, Neijiang. It will be constructed in three phases, building 300,000 tons/year LIB recycling and reutilization production lines. Upon completion, it will achieve an annual recycling and reutilization capacity of 300,000 tons of LIBs, realizing green circular development of waste battery recycling, cascade utilization, and material regeneration.

Hyundai Motor has started moving production line equipment into MAAC (Mobility Alpha-line Anseong Campus), its first in-house battery plant. The plant’s initial production capacity is understood to be 2 GWh per year. Hyundai Motor will use NCM batteries, rather than LFP batteries, and plans to first build a pouch-type battery production line this year. The company is also expected to discuss prismatic battery production next year.

【30k-ton Waste LIB Recycling and Reutilization Project Launched in Beichen, Tianjin】 Recently, the annual 30,000-ton waste LIB recycling and reutilization project entered its second EIA public announcement stage. The project is located in Xiditou Town Industrial Park, Beichen District, Tianjin. It is an expansion project that utilizes leased factory space to install one LIB cell crushing and sorting line, one un-electrolyte-deposited LIB cell crushing and sorting line, one LIB electrode sheet crushing and sorting line, and supporting environmental equipment. Upon completion, it will achieve an annual capacity of 10,000 tons of LIB cells, 10,000 tons of un-electrolyte-deposited cells, and 10,000 tons of electrode sheets, totaling 30,000 tons of waste LIBs per year.

【12k-ton Waste LIB and Electrode Sheet Material Production Project Launched in Longyan, Fujian】 Recently, the government of Longyan, Fujian, released the EIA approval notice for the waste LIB and electrode sheet material production project. The project involves a total investment of RMB 5.4 million, located in Sanchuang Park, Xinluo District, Longyan. It consists of newly built battery pack pre-treatment area, battery pack dismantling area, module dismantling area, cell dismantling area, and electrode sheet sorting area. Upon completion, it will achieve an annual processing capacity of 12,000 tons of waste LIBs and electrode sheet materials.
